The licensing program does not include Mountain Leader or First Aid training, because you may or may not choose to run your own Ascent programs in the mountain/outdoor environment. If you do want to run Ascent outdoors, we can help you to source the other technical training that you may need. We would not advise you to run Ascent in mountain regions if you are unfamiliar with the area. Alternatively, a licensed Ascent coach may choose to partner with a Mountain Leader to run Ascent experiences.

The Ascent experience
It is very important that, before you can guide other people through the Ascent journey, you experience Ascent yourself as a fully immersed participant, working on your own goals and achieving the personal alignment and balance that is fundamental to your role as an Ascent coach. |
| January 2007 |
Coaching Fundamentals - 9 days (3 x 3 days)
In this set of three modules, you will learn an extremely powerful set of coaching and personal change tools. These will take you beyond any typical coaching course to a level of skill where you can get to the root of an issue quickly and use specific change techniques to bring about transformational change as part of the Ascent journey.
You will receive a number of books and also a recommended viewing list to help you understand and interpret the role of the guide in the hero's journey.
The location for this will be a residential retreat. |
| February 2007 |
Ascent Coaching - 3 days
In order to fully create the Ascent Experience, you will need to understand the significance and role of the hero's journey, and the way that this journey manifests itself in our lives. Ascent uses a number of unique coaching tools that you need to become very comfortable in using to ensure consistent results for your guests.
You will also learn about the outdoor and physical aspects of Ascent, and what you need to do to ensure the safety of your guests.
The location for this will be a residential retreat. |
| March 2007 |
Adventure Coaching - 3 days
We will run through a full Ascent experience with you able to participate, observe and ask the questions that you need to ask. This is a unique approach as we travel the Ascent journey together, stopping along the way to explore the nature of the journey itself. You will gain an unprecedented insight into the running of Ascent so that you can gain the confidence you need as quickly as you want to. You will also see the behind the scenes work that you need to do to run Ascent.
The location for this will be on the mountain. |
| |
Continuous Assessment - during each module
At the end of each module, you will be given a personal assessment with objective feedback against the Ascent coaching criteria and specific recommendations to develop your skills further. This highly personalised approach enables you to fully achieve your potential, and enables us to maintain the high quality of Ascent which benefits you as a potential licensee. |
| |
Coach Assessment - During your first Ascent Experience
Ascent is a unique experience, and our interest is not in creating the maximum number of licencees but the highest quality. Therefore, the end of the training program has an individual assessment that tests your ability to put this into practice and get results for your clients. |
